The Importance of Wireless Communication in Next-Generation Networks

Wireless communication technology has rapidly evolved and become indispensable in next-generation networks. As the demand for seamless connectivity and high-speed data transmission continues to rise, understanding the importance of wireless communication is crucial for both individuals and businesses.

One of the primary advantages of wireless communication is its ability to provide mobility. In today’s fast-paced world, users expect to stay connected regardless of their location. Whether on the move or working from home, wireless networks enable instant access to information and services without the constraints of physical cables. This enhances productivity and fosters collaboration among teams spread across different geographic locations.

With the implementation of advanced technologies, such as 5G and beyond, wireless communication is set to transform how we interact with devices. 5G networks promise ultra-low latency and high bandwidth, which are essential for applications such as autonomous vehicles, smart cities, and the Internet of Things (IoT). By facilitating real-time data transfer, these technologies empower various sectors, from healthcare to manufacturing, to operate more efficiently and effectively.

Security is another critical concern in wireless communication. Next-generation networks integrate advanced security protocols to protect sensitive data against potential cybersecurity threats. Innovations like network slicing and improved encryption methods help ensure safer transmissions and more reliable connections. As businesses increasingly rely on wireless communications, addressing these security challenges becomes paramount.

Moreover, wireless communication supports diverse applications, including augmented reality (AR) and virtual reality (VR), which are gaining traction in sectors like education and entertainment. The ability to stream high-quality content without interruptions enhances user experience, which is vital in retaining customer engagement in competitive markets.

The environmental impact of wireless technology also merits attention. Wireless communication reduces the need for extensive physical infrastructure, leading to lower carbon footprints in network deployment. As sustainability becomes a priority for organizations globally, leveraging wireless technology for efficient resource utilization aligns with eco-friendly initiatives.
